Tag: jython

8. Region of Interest

8. Region of Interest: 관심영역 포토샵 등에서 이미지를 처리할 때, 대부분 특정 부분을 선택하여 처리합니다. 눈을 키운다던가, 볼 터치를 화사하게 한다던가, 보기 싫은 뾰루지를 지우던가 하죠. 이렇게 이미지 프로세싱을 적용할 특정 영역을 관심영역(ROI: Region of Interest)라고 합니다. ImageJ에서는 ROI를

7. Batch Processing

7. Batch Processing: 이미지 일괄 처리Reference A Fiji Scripting Tutorial #3. Inspecting properties and pixels of an image 대량의 이미지를 한번에 처리해야 하는 경우, 이미지를 하나 하나 불러오는 것보다 일괄처리가 효과적입니다. 이미지가 모여 있는 폴더를 지정할 수도

6. Image Data 분석

6.1. ImagePlus: ImageJ의 이미지 instanceReference TCP School 26) 클래스의 개념ImagePlus 지난 글에서 객체지향 프로그래밍(OOP: Object Oriented Programming)의 개념을 짧게 설명했습니다. instance란 것은 Class에 정의된 대로 만들어진 객체입니다. 자동차 설계도(Cla

5. Python Script 작성

5.1. ImageJ Script 예시Reference A Fiji Scripting Tutorial #3. Inspecting properties and pixels of an imageA Fiji Scripting Tutorial #4. Finding the java documentation for any class Javadocs: ImageJ1,

4. Python Basic

4.1. Python 문법을 공부하는 이유 ImageJ에서 활용하는 jython은 Java Virtual Machine (JVM) 위에서 python을 구현한 것입니다. 주로 web 환경에 많이 사용되는 JVM과 python의 연동이 자유로워 Java Class와 .jar 파일을 아무런 변환이나 노력 없이 그대로 끌어다 사용할 수 있다는 장점이 있습니다